## About

Free 3D model of a medieval manuscript in progress: an open bifolium on a board, one leaf written and one ruled and started, with a worked initial and lead weights. Dimensions 0.62 by 0.20 by 0.44 m (X by Y by Z). Metre units, +Y up, +Z front, origin on the footprint at ground level. A hero dressing prop for a scriptorium desk, 0.62 m across the board. Every written line is an abstract rib of ink at the rhythm of a written line, not a letter in any script, and the initial is plain geometric colour with no figure in it, so the page reproduces no real text. Invented throughout: no real building, institution or text is reproduced, and any written surface carries abstract marks rather than letters. Claustral palette: limestone ashlar and darker rubble stone, lime plaster, oak and pine, lead, wrought iron, brass, parchment, undyed linen, madder and garden green. Static geometry; no rig, animation, collision or navigation data.

## Use with three.js

```js
import { GLTFLoader } from 'three/addons/loaders/GLTFLoader.js'

const loader = new GLTFLoader()
loader.load('https://cdn.3dassets.dev/assets/37394/v1/model.glb', (gltf) => {
  scene.add(gltf.scene)
})
```

## Blender

```python
# Blender 4.x: File > Import > glTF 2.0, or from the Python console after downloading the file.
import bpy
bpy.ops.import_scene.gltf(filepath='model.glb')  # from https://cdn.3dassets.dev/assets/37394/v1/model.glb
# Metres and +Y up are converted to Blender's Z-up scene automatically.
```

## Godot

```gdscript
# Godot 4: copy model.glb into res://models/ and the editor imports it as a scene.
var packed := load("res://models/model.glb") as PackedScene
var model := packed.instantiate()
add_child(model)
```

## Unity

```csharp
// Unity: import model.glb with glTFast (Package Manager: com.unity.cloud.gltfast) and drag the prefab in,
// or load it at runtime straight from the CDN:
using GLTFast;
var gltf = new GltfImport();
if (await gltf.Load("https://cdn.3dassets.dev/assets/37394/v1/model.glb")) await gltf.InstantiateMainSceneAsync(transform);
```
